Shutting Down
- Turn off tracking
- On the TCS panel,
flip down the [TRACKING] switch
- Park the dome
- Send the dome home: On the TCS panel, flip down the [DOME TRACK] switch.
- Wait until the dome stops moving. You can hear it while it is moving.
- Halt the dome: On the TCS panel, flip down the [AUTO DOME] switch.
- Replace the
Shower Cap and
Finder Scope Cover
- Upstairs: move the telescope to due north, as described in
Starting Up, Step 8.
- Use the stepladder to replace them.
- Secure the outside door, if it was opened.
- Turn off the venting fan, if it was turned on, by rotating
the thermostat clockwise.
- Turn of the CCD Power Strip, located on the North side of the telescope itself.
- Turn off the dome lights.
- Exit the Dome, closing the firedoor as you exit.
- Pull out the black knob in the upper left of the door, and pull down
on the handled cord as you descend the stairs.
- Close the mirror doors
- On the TCS panel,
flip the [MIRROR DOORS] switch all the way down
(it has three positions).
- On the TCS console:
- 4) Miscellaneous Menu
- 5) Open/Close Doors
- Type 0, then NO
- 0) Return to Main Menu
- Close the dome doors
- On the TCS console:
- 4) Miscellaneous Menu
- 6) Open/Close Dome
- Type 0, then NO
- 0) Return to Main Menu
- Wait for the doors to close (about 2 minutes)
- Put the telescope in the Home Position
- On the TCS console:
- 2) Movement Menu
- 5) Zenith
- 7) Start Slew
- Emergence: if the telescope is pointed too far toward the horizon, then sometime it gets stuck. To point it back, just push it towards zenith with your hands, then use the slew paddle to adjust it.
- When the telescope has stopped slewing (about 30 s. The
TCS quietly beeps when it is done), turn the drives off.
- On the TCS panel, flip down the [DRIVES] switch.
- On the TCS panel, press in the [HALT MOTORS] button.
- button in = motors off
- button out = motors on
- At this point, all toggle switches on the TCS panel on the top row should
be down except [TRACK/TRACK AUX] which should be up and [EXCOM] which may be up
or down, and the [HALT MOTORS] button should be pushed in.
- Log out of the ICC (aka telescope2)
- Depends on the window manager
- Do not turn the computers off!
The ICC computer MUST be left on, as it is part of the JCA Linux Network.
The TCS computer and console should remain on for ease of use.
- Turn off all the monitors, lights.
- Lock the Door and Go Home.
- Double check as you are driving away, that the dome is really closed.
